A Schuylkill County woman is facing a felony retail theft charge following what police say is her thirteenth such offense.
On the afternoon of Oct. 16, State Police were called to the Sheetz store on Route 61 in North Manheim Township. While reviewing store surveillance footage, police say they witnessed Chiquita Stokes, 50, of Pottsville, getting out of the passenger side of a vehicle parked at the gas pumps.
Stokes reportedly enters the store and places a cheeseburger in her purse.
She is later seen leaving the store with a list of assorted items, including a bottle of Pepsi, a pack of Albanese gummies, a fountain soda, 13 Big Sipz drinks, 2 BuzzBallz, 2 Stumble Guys, a bag of Utz chips, and a pack of toilet paper.
The total value of the items stolen equals $100.16, store management told police.
Also on the video, police say it’s evident that Stokes is wearing an ankle monitor.
After checking her record, police say Stokes is currently on probation from Chester County.
Stokes is currently housed in Chester County Prison and will be arraigned on her retail theft charge from Schuylkill County on Monday.
